The range of roles available within state settings reflects the wide scope of public administration tasks, as evidenced by the many career paths in the Italy government. Policy development roles necessitate analytical thinking and study skills, incorporating the creation of frameworks that direct government decision processes. Service delivery roles focus on direct interaction with citizens, needing excellent interaction skills and customer service focus. Technical specialists manage infrastructure projects, ecological undertakings, and digital transformation efforts that modernize state operations. Financial management roles supervise financial plan allocation and expenditure monitoring, guaranteeing prudent utilization of public resources. Personnel divisions within government organisations manage recruitment, training, and employee relations for extensive workforces. Legal consultants offer guidance on compliance subjects. Communications groups oversee public information initiatives and stakeholder engagement. Each of these fields offers distinct career routes with opportunities for specialization and growth.
Work-life balance remains one of the greatest eye-catching of public sector employment, setting apart it notably from many private sector options. Federal entities usually offer versatile working plans, including options for remote work, compressed working weeks, and job-sharing arrangements. Such formats acknowledge the importance of employee well-being while maintaining operations criteria, as evident in careers in the UK government. Annual leave benefits are typically abundant, often surpassing private sector norms, and feature extra measures for unique conditions such as research leave or volunteer work. Pension plans in the public sector are normally sound, providing long-term financial security that most independent employers cannot match. Healthcare benefits are detailed, often encompassing relatives and offering precautionary care initiatives. The emphasis on employee welfare includes psychological well-being support, with many government entities offering supportive programs and stress-management tools. Parental and paternity leave provisions are often substantially generous than statutory minimums, showcasing the public sector's dedication to supporting working families.
Career advancement within public arena organisations requires a thorough understanding of the distinct systems and advancement pathways accessible to employees. Unlike non-public employment, state roles commonly follow set grading systems and competency schemes that provide clear development opportunities. Professional development training schemes are typically comprehensive, providing training in leadership, task management and specific technical skills pertinent to specific departments. Numerous public field workers gain from mentorship plans that pair seasoned civil servants with newcomers, promoting knowledge transfer and job guidance. The organized nature of government employment indicates that career strategy can be extra predictable, with specified advancement standards and routine work reviews.
